## Mechanism of Action

Linoleic acid (43.86-46.67%) and oleic acid (28.19-30.56%) scavenge DPPH• and ABTS•+ radicals in dose-dependent manner, while γ-tocopherol at 599.33 mg/kg provides potent [antioxidant protection](/ingredients/condition/antioxidant). Phenolic compounds including ferulic acid, syringic acid, and chlorogenic acid inhibit hyaluronidase, collagenase, and tyrosinase enzymes. The 8 kDa peptide fraction demonstrates antifungal activity at 375 µg/mL, while α-/β-moschin peptides inhibit protein translation at IC50 values of 17 µM and 300 nM respectively.

## Clinical Summary

Current evidence for Austrian pumpkin seed oil is limited to in vitro studies, with no published human clinical trials providing efficacy data. Laboratory studies show PSO2 aqueous enzymatic extract at 10% w/v demonstrated highest ABTS•+ radical inhibition comparable to ascorbic acid (p < 0.005). Chloroform/methanol extracts contained 54.41 mg GAE/kg phenolics with DPPH scavenging capacity of 250 µmol Trolox/kg. While extensive research supports Cucurbita pepo seeds for prostate health and BPH management, specific clinical data for the Austrian Styrian variety requires further investigation.

## Safety & Drug Interactions

No safety concerns, drug interactions, or contraindications are reported in current literature for Austrian pumpkin seed oil. The oil is generally recognized as safe for nutritional and cosmetic applications with no documented adverse effects. However, individuals with pumpkin or seed allergies should exercise caution. Pregnant and breastfeeding women should consult healthcare providers before use, as safety data in these populations is not established.

### What makes Austrian pumpkin seeds different from regular pumpkin seeds?

Austrian pumpkin seeds from Cucurbita pepo var. styriaca are hull-less with higher concentrations of linoleic acid (43.86-46.67%) and γ-tocopherol (599.33 mg/kg). They're specifically cultivated in Austria's Styrian region and contain unique peptide fractions with antifungal properties at 375 µg/mL.
